What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Cutler, CA?

In Cutler, CA, the average monthly cost for assisted living typically ranges from $3,500 to $5,000, depending on the level of care, amenities, and specific facility. This is generally lower than the state average for California, making Cutler a more affordable option within the Central Valley region.

Are there any assisted living facilities in Cutler that accept Medicaid (Medi-Cal in California)?

Yes, some assisted living facilities in and around Cutler, CA may accept Medi-Cal through the Assisted Living Waiver (ALW) program. However, availability is limited, and it's important to contact facilities directly or consult with the Tulare County Area Agency on Aging to confirm participation and eligibility requirements.

What types of services and amenities are commonly offered by assisted living facilities in Cutler?

Assisted living facilities in Cutler, CA typically offer services such as medication management, ass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s), housekeeping, meals, and social activities. Many also provide transportation for local appointments and outings, taking advantage of Cutler's proximity to larger cities like Visalia for additional resources and medical care.

How are assisted living facilities regulated in Cutler, California?

Assisted living facilities in Cutler, CA are licensed and regulated by the California Department of Social Services, Community Care Licensing Division. They must comply with state regulations outlined in the California Code of Regulations, Title 22, which covers staffing, safety, resident care, and facility standards to ensure quality and safety for residents.

What local resources in Cutler support seniors and their families when considering assisted living?

Seniors and families in Cutler, CA can access resources such as the Tulare County Area Agency on Aging, which provides information and assistance on senior services, including assisted living options. Local senior centers and healthcare providers in the Cutler area also offer guidance and support for transitioning to assisted living.

Cutler Assisted Living Costs: Your Monthly Budget Guide

Understanding the average monthly cost for assisted living is a crucial step for families in Cutler navigating the journey of finding the right care for a loved one. It’s a topic that often comes with a mix of concern and uncertainty, but having clear, local information can empower you to make confident decisions. In California, and specifically in the Central Valley region that includes communities like Cutler, costs can vary significantly based on the level of care, amenities, and the specific location of the community.

Nationally, figures often cite averages between $4,000 and $6,000 per month, but in California, you can generally expect those numbers to be higher. For the Cutler area, which is influenced by the broader Fresno County market, average monthly costs for a private, one-bedroom apartment in an assisted living community typically range from approximately $3,500 to $5,500. It’s important to view this as a starting point, as the final cost is deeply personal. A smaller studio apartment or a shared suite will naturally be on the lower end of that spectrum, while a larger private apartment with a premium view or more extensive care needs will trend toward the higher end.

What exactly does this monthly fee cover? Typically, it includes rent for the private living space, all utilities except perhaps a personal phone line, three daily meals and snacks, housekeeping and linen services, scheduled transportation for appointments or outings, and a core package of personal care assistance. This assistance includes help with activities of daily living like bathing, dressing, grooming, and medication management. The climate in Cutler, with its hot, dry summers and mild winters, is often a consideration for communities, which may feature secure courtyards, shaded walking paths, and air-conditioned common areas to ensure comfort year-round, all included in the base cost.

The key to budgeting accurately is understanding that the quoted base rate is often just the beginning. Most communities use a tiered care model. This means your loved one’s cost is assessed individually based on their specific needs. If they require more frequent assistance with mobility, more complex medication regimens, or specialized memory care support, those services will add to the monthly fee. This personalized approach ensures your parent pays for the support they truly need, but it necessitates a thorough assessment during the tour. Always ask for a detailed, written breakdown of what the quoted price includes and what would constitute additional charges.

For families in Cutler exploring options, practical advice is to schedule in-person tours at several local communities. During these visits, ask direct questions about all potential fees. Inquire about community fees, potential annual increases, and policies regarding care plan changes. Remember, the value is not just in the square footage but in the quality of care, the engagement of the staff, and the overall atmosphere. Look for a community where your loved one feels at home and socially connected. Financing this care often involves a combination of personal savings, pensions, long-term care insurance, and for those who qualify, veterans’ benefits or Medi-Cal programs like the Assisted Living Waiver.
